There's a local auction coming up for a car that's advertised as a real Z-11 Pace Car. Very little info has been included in the listing other than the pictures below and that it's a 350, 4 speed car. What do you guys think of the tag? The rivet on the left looks like it's been drilled out.

Thanks,

Bob
Title: Re: Z11 Pace Car Auction
Post by: william on October 29, 2015, 09:44:09 PM
Tag looks ok. Common for the caulk to fall out of the rivets.
Title: Re: Z11 Pace Car Auction
Post by: 69pace on October 30, 2015, 01:41:26 AM
Yeah I don't hate the tag. The valve covers are wrong, and the air cleaner is missing the decal on the lid and the emissions sticker on the side so maybe some work has been done. What's the vin I wonder?
